Summary
Intel Corporation (INTC) announced on May 11, 2011, a significant decision by its Board of Directors to increase its quarterly cash dividend. This dividend raise is set to commence with the dividend declared in the third quarter of 2011. This action signals confidence from Intel's management in the company's financial health and its ability to generate sufficient cash flow to reward shareholders more generously. For investors, this dividend increase is a positive indicator of Intel's commitment to returning capital to shareholders. It suggests a stable or growing earnings outlook and a strategic focus on shareholder value. Investors should note that this announcement was made via a press release furnished as part of an 8-K filing, indicating it's a material event concerning corporate finance and shareholder returns.
